## Build Provenance: Incremental Static Rebuilds

The Petrelpress site generator now records, for every incremental rebuild, the exact content hash set and dependency graph slice used to produce changed pages. Release managers should verify that a partial rebuild's provenance record chains back to a fully attested baseline build; any gap means a full rebuild is required before promotion. Cache entries without provenance are treated as stale. The attested baseline for this cycle is identified by the token below.

pipeline stamp: htk31_f769b577b3028a4e9958e5bb8d1259a

MEMO — Proposed Joint Venture with Ostrel Fabrication

To: Heads of Department

After three months of due diligence, the board is ready to advance the joint venture with Ostrel Fabrication covering the Larkspan composites line. The proposed structure is a 50/50 entity based in Merrowgate, with shared tooling and staggered capital contributions. Each department head should assess resourcing impacts before Friday's session. Please review the confidential note on our business plans below.

board note of bawep-tajef: Queniusek Systems plans to raise the Quenvan list price by 53.1 percent in March. The pricing group signed off on a budget of $176.4 million for Project Drueth. The renewal with Casionix Partners closes at $142.5 million a year, 8.3 percent below the last contract. Project Fraax slips by six weeks because of the tooling delay.

The autocomplete index in Quillfox rebuilds on every keystroke batch, which is why staging feels sluggish. Don't touch the trie logic — it's fine. The problem is the debounce and shard fan-out settings, which were copied from the old Lanternbee service and never revisited. New folks: read the indexer doc first, then adjust only these. The constants to tune are as follows.

tuning table, yajog-yahof:
BUDGETS = {
    "lamvan": 303,
    "wenox": 460,
    "fenvan": 525,
}